Update on the Bitbucket Cloud Client

Over the last few releases, we have continued to add significant support to Bitbucket Cloud. Now with over 85 actions, Bitbucket Cloud client is now on par with Bitbucket Server in most aspects and has unique support for Pipelines and Runners enabling automation of your Bitbucket Cloud build environment.

This is especially significant for helping teams migrate over to Bitbucket Cloud from server environments including Bitbucket Datacenter and Server and Bamboo Datacenter and Server. Internally, we have been on Bitbucket Cloud for some time and in the past year have migrated from Bamboo to Pipelines with the help of the ACLI support for Bitbucket Cloud.

Look for more improvements coming in the next couple of releases.

Here is a quick side by side comparison of actions for Bitbucket Server and Bitbucket Cloud.

acli bitbucket -a getClientInfo --outputType text --outputFormat 11 --columns client,name 109 actions in list Client Name bitbucket addAccessToken bitbucket addApplicationLink bitbucket addBranch bitbucket addBranchRestriction bitbucket addGroup bitbucket addReviewCondition bitbucket addSshKey bitbucket addUser bitbucket addUserToGroup bitbucket addWebhook bitbucket createBranch bitbucket createProject bitbucket createPullRequest bitbucket createRepository bitbucket declinePullRequest bitbucket deleteBranch bitbucket deleteProject bitbucket deleteRepository bitbucket disableHook bitbucket enableHook bitbucket getAccessTokenList bitbucket getApp bitbucket getApplicationLink bitbucket getApplicationLinkList bitbucket getAuditLogList bitbucket getBranch bitbucket getBranchList bitbucket getBranchRestriction bitbucket getBranchRestrictionList bitbucket getBuildStatusList bitbucket getClientInfo bitbucket getCommit bitbucket getCommitList bitbucket getFileInfo bitbucket getFileList bitbucket getGroupList bitbucket getHook bitbucket getHookList bitbucket getPermissionList bitbucket getProject bitbucket getProjectList bitbucket getProjectPermissionList bitbucket getPullRequest bitbucket getPullRequestList bitbucket getReplacementVariableList bitbucket getRepository bitbucket getRepositoryList bitbucket getRepositoryPermissionList bitbucket getReviewConditionList bitbucket getServerInfo bitbucket getSource bitbucket getSqlResultList bitbucket getSshKeyList bitbucket getUpgradeInfo bitbucket getUser bitbucket getUserList bitbucket getWebhookList bitbucket grantPermissions bitbucket grantProjectPermissions bitbucket grantRepositoryPermissions bitbucket help bitbucket installApp bitbucket mergePullRequest bitbucket provideFeedback bitbucket removeAccessToken bitbucket removeApplicationLink bitbucket removeBranch bitbucket removeBranchRestriction bitbucket removeGroup bitbucket removeReviewCondition bitbucket removeSshKey bitbucket removeSshKeys bitbucket removeUser bitbucket removeUserFromGroup bitbucket removeWebhook bitbucket renderRequest bitbucket revokePermissions bitbucket revokeProjectPermissions bitbucket revokeRepositoryPermissions bitbucket run bitbucket runFromApplicationLinkList bitbucket runFromBranchList bitbucket runFromBranchRestrictionList bitbucket runFromCommitList bitbucket runFromCsv bitbucket runFromGroupList bitbucket runFromJson bitbucket runFromList bitbucket runFromProjectList bitbucket runFromPropertyFile bitbucket runFromPullRequestList bitbucket runFromRepositoryList bitbucket runFromReviewConditionList bitbucket runFromSql bitbucket runFromUserList bitbucket runFromWebhookList bitbucket runIf bitbucket setBuildStatus bitbucket setReplacementVariables bitbucket sleep bitbucket updateBranchRestriction bitbucket updateHook bitbucket updateProject bitbucket updatePullRequest bitbucket updateRepository bitbucket updateReviewCondition bitbucket updateUser bitbucket updateWebhook bitbucket validateLicense
acli bitbucketcloud -a getClientInfo --outputType text --outputFormat 11 --columns client,name 88 actions in list Client Name bitbucketcloud addDownload bitbucketcloud addEnvironment bitbucketcloud addRunner bitbucketcloud addVariables bitbucketcloud approveCommit bitbucketcloud approvePullRequest bitbucketcloud createBranch bitbucketcloud createCommit bitbucketcloud createProject bitbucketcloud createPullRequest bitbucketcloud declinePullRequest bitbucketcloud deleteBranch bitbucketcloud deleteProject bitbucketcloud exportData bitbucketcloud getBranch bitbucketcloud getBranchList bitbucketcloud getBuildStatusList bitbucketcloud getClientInfo bitbucketcloud getCommit bitbucketcloud getCommitList bitbucketcloud getDeploymentList bitbucketcloud getDownload bitbucketcloud getDownloadList bitbucketcloud getEnvironment bitbucketcloud getEnvironmentList bitbucketcloud getFileList bitbucketcloud getPipeline bitbucketcloud getPipelineCache bitbucketcloud getPipelineCacheList bitbucketcloud getPipelineList bitbucketcloud getPipelineStep bitbucketcloud getPipelineStepList bitbucketcloud getProject bitbucketcloud getProjectList bitbucketcloud getPullRequest bitbucketcloud getPullRequestList bitbucketcloud getReplacementVariableList bitbucketcloud getRepository bitbucketcloud getRepositoryList bitbucketcloud getRunner bitbucketcloud getRunnerList bitbucketcloud getSource bitbucketcloud getSqlResultList bitbucketcloud getUpgradeInfo bitbucketcloud getUser bitbucketcloud getVariableList bitbucketcloud getWorkspace bitbucketcloud getWorkspaceList bitbucketcloud help bitbucketcloud mergePullRequest bitbucketcloud provideFeedback bitbucketcloud publishSource bitbucketcloud removeDownload bitbucketcloud removeEnvironment bitbucketcloud removePipelineCache bitbucketcloud removeRunner bitbucketcloud removeVariables bitbucketcloud renderRequest bitbucketcloud restartPipeline bitbucketcloud run bitbucketcloud runFromBranchList bitbucketcloud runFromCommitList bitbucketcloud runFromCsv bitbucketcloud runFromDeploymentList bitbucketcloud runFromDownloadList bitbucketcloud runFromEnvironmentList bitbucketcloud runFromJson bitbucketcloud runFromList bitbucketcloud runFromPipelineList bitbucketcloud runFromPipelineStepList bitbucketcloud runFromProjectList bitbucketcloud runFromPropertyFile bitbucketcloud runFromPullRequestList bitbucketcloud runFromRepositoryList bitbucketcloud runFromRunnerList bitbucketcloud runFromSql bitbucketcloud runFromWorkspaceList bitbucketcloud runIf bitbucketcloud setReplacementVariables bitbucketcloud sleep bitbucketcloud startPipeline bitbucketcloud startPipelineStep bitbucketcloud stopPipeline bitbucketcloud unapproveCommit bitbucketcloud unapprovePullRequest bitbucketcloud updateProject bitbucketcloud updatePullRequest bitbucketcloud updateVariables

Log a request with our support team.

Confluence®, Jira®, Atlassian Bamboo®, Bitbucket®, Fisheye®, and Atlassian Crucible® are registered trademarks of Atlassian®
Copyright © 2005 - 2024 Appfire | All rights reserved. Appfire™, the 'Apps for makers™' slogan and Bob Swift Atlassian Apps™ are all trademarks of Appfire Technologies, LLC.